实时大数据可视化技术如何保证数据安全?

在当今这个大数据时代,实时大数据可视化技术已经成为企业、政府和个人获取信息、辅助决策的重要手段。然而,随着数据量的激增,数据安全问题也日益凸显。那么,如何保证实时大数据可视化技术下的数据安全呢?本文将从以下几个方面进行探讨。

一、数据加密技术

数据加密是保证数据安全的基础。在实时大数据可视化过程中,对数据进行加密处理,可以有效防止数据泄露。以下是一些常用的数据加密技术:

  1. 对称加密算法:如AES(高级加密标准)、DES(数据加密标准)等。对称加密算法具有加密速度快、安全性高等优点,但密钥分发和管理较为复杂。

  2. 非对称加密算法:如RSA、ECC等。非对称加密算法可以实现密钥的分离管理,提高安全性,但加密速度相对较慢。

  3. 哈希算法:如SHA-256、MD5等。哈希算法可以保证数据的完整性,防止数据被篡改。

二、访问控制技术

访问控制是保证数据安全的重要手段。在实时大数据可视化过程中,通过以下措施实现访问控制:

  1. 用户身份认证:对用户进行身份验证,确保只有授权用户才能访问数据。

  2. 权限管理:根据用户角色和职责,设置不同的访问权限,限制用户对数据的操作。

  3. 审计日志:记录用户访问数据的行为,以便在发生安全事件时进行追踪和调查。

三、数据脱敏技术

数据脱敏是指在保证数据安全的前提下,对敏感数据进行处理,使其在不影响业务分析的前提下,无法被识别和还原。以下是一些常用的数据脱敏技术:

  1. 数据掩码:对敏感数据进行部分遮挡,如身份证号码、手机号码等。

  2. 数据替换:将敏感数据替换为随机生成的数据,如将姓名替换为姓名拼音首字母。

  3. 数据脱敏库:使用数据脱敏库对敏感数据进行处理,提高数据脱敏的效率和准确性。

四、安全审计与监控

安全审计与监控是实时大数据可视化数据安全的重要保障。以下是一些安全审计与监控措施:

  1. 安全审计:定期对系统进行安全审计,检查是否存在安全漏洞和异常行为。

  2. 入侵检测:部署入侵检测系统,实时监控数据访问行为,发现异常情况及时报警。

  3. 安全事件响应:制定安全事件响应计划,确保在发生安全事件时能够迅速应对。

案例分析

某知名互联网公司在其实时大数据可视化平台中,采用了以下措施保证数据安全:

  1. 对数据进行AES加密,确保数据在传输和存储过程中的安全性。

  2. 对用户进行身份认证和权限管理,限制用户对数据的访问。

  3. 对敏感数据进行脱敏处理,防止数据泄露。

  4. 部署入侵检测系统,实时监控数据访问行为。

通过以上措施,该公司成功保证了实时大数据可视化平台下的数据安全,为企业提供了稳定可靠的数据服务。

总结

实时大数据可视化技术在保证数据安全方面具有重要作用。通过采用数据加密、访问控制、数据脱敏、安全审计与监控等技术手段,可以有效保障数据安全。企业在实际应用中,应根据自身需求选择合适的技术方案,确保数据安全。

猜你喜欢:SkyWalking